A productive, high-quality robotic welding cell is created in collaboration between a robot integrator, a welding machine supplier, and a workpiece designer. The best solution for customizing a robotic welding cell is found when reliable welding equipment with different detection functions meets automation expertise early on in the design phase.

The groove angle has a direct impact on the efficiency and productivity of welding heavy metal structures. Kemppi's new solution, Reduced Gap Technology (RGT) changes the understanding of narrow gap welding. The new technology challenges conventional joint design principles.

Welding safety has become increasingly demanding. The hazards at the arc remain constant, but modern working conditions mean exposure can accumulate over longer shifts and in tighter indoor spaces. As a result, welding PPE needs to be treated as both protection for the welder and proof of compliance. At Kemppi, welding safety PPE is designed and validated in practice through clear requirements, welder-led feedback, and verified compliance with EU PPE Regulation 2016/425, CE marking processes, and relevant EN standards.
